The Ageing Well industry incorporates: Healthy Ageing –“The process of developing and maintaining the functional ability that enables wellbeing in older age”, where “functional ability comprises the health-related attributes that enable people to be and to do what they have reason to value”. South Australia’s Plan for Ageing Well 2020-2025 (PDF 2MB) outlines the State Government and community’s vision and priorities for ageing well for all South Australians over the next five years. Engagement is not only about giving older people a voice, it is about ensuring older people are valued and respectfully included in the decisions that ultimately affect them. Resilience, well-being and ‘healthy’ ageing Theme 3.2 This work package will consolidate work on resilience and well-being, building on data sets such as CFAS Wales and Lifestyle Matters to apply theoretical and conceptual understanding to a range of age related contexts, including health, social circumstances and care-giving.
